Palsud, Maheshwar

Palsud is a village and Gram Panchayat of the Maheshwar Tehsil in Khargone district of Madhya Pradesh, which falls under Maheshwar block. You can reach there by taking a bus till Piplya Bujurg bus stop which is around 3 km away.

As on May 2024, the current population of Palsud is 1.9 thousands out of which 959 are males and rest 958 are females. The sex ratio of this village is 999 females per 1000 males. There are around 190 teenagers in Palsud. It has literacy rate of 65% which means around 1.2 thousands persons can read and write. Total 401 people belonging to scheduled caste and 35 scheduled tribe people live in the village. There are around 433 households in Palsud, which means every family has 4 members on average. The village has working population of 1 thousands. The pincode of Palsud is 451225 and there are many postoffices around the village which can used to send speed post, registered parcel etc.
